METHOD AND SYSTEM FOR ASSESSMENT OF PIPELINE CONDITION BY GENERATING A PLURALITY OF PRESSURE WAVES AND DETECTING THE INTERACTION SIGNAL FROM A LOCALISED VARIATION AND COMPARING THE ACTUAL SIGNAL TO A PREDICTED DATA MODEL

摘要

591739 Disclosed is a method for assessing the extent and location of localised variations in pipe condition, corrosion, elastic stiffness, thickness, or internal cross sectional area of the pipe wall along a length of a pipe carrying a fluid or liquid. The method includes the steps of generating a pressure wave in the fluid being carried along the pipe and detecting a pressure wave interaction signal resulting from an interaction of the pressure wave with localised variations in pipe condition along a length of the pipe. The timing of the pressure wave interaction signals determines the locations of the localised variations in pipe condition, and the extent of the localised variation in pipe condition is determined based on a change in the magnitude of the pressure wave interaction signal.
